Fresh off of his victory over fellow UFC Hall of Famer Mark “The Hammer” Coleman at UFC 109, former UFC Heavyweight and Light Heavyweight Champion Randy “The Natural” Couture may clash with former 185-pound champ Rich “Ace” Franklin at UFC 115 on June 12th. Sherdog.com first reported on the proposed light heavyweight bout.
The fight remains in the “early stages of planning” and hinges partly on Couture’s availability due to his burgeoning film career. Couture confirmed plans for the bout earlier today.
Couture (18-10-0) has won two straight fights since dropping back down to the light heavyweight division after losses to Brock Lesnar and Antonio Rodrigo “Minotauro” Nogueira at heavyweight. He earned a close and contested decision victory over Brandon “The Truth” Vera at UFC 105 and dispatched of Coleman in just over six minutes in their headlining bout at UFC 109 on Saturday. A third straight win at 205 could potentially place Couture in line for a title shot.
Franklin (25-5-0, 1 NC) has recently engaged in 195-pound catchweight bouts as he works back up to the light heavyweight division after a second crushing loss to UFC Middleweight Champion Anderson “The Spider” Silva back at UFC 77. He has gone 3-2 since the loss to Silva, but is coming off of a one-sided loss to Vitor “The Phenom” Belfort at UFC 103, which saw Franklin stopped in just three minutes. A win over Couture would get Franklin back on-track, but a title shot is likely not in his immediate future.
UFC 115 is set for June 12th at General Motors Place in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. The proposed Couture-Franklin bout would likely serve as the night’s main event should it take place.
